Bedford Regional Medical Center's oncology program was established in 1988. It has been accredited by the American College of Surgeons since 1995.
Our oncologist is board certified in oncology and hematology. Our nursing staff have completed an intensive chemotherapy/biotherapy course. We participate in clinical trials under Methodist Hospital's research umbrella. Therefore, offering our patients the cutting edge in the treatment of cancer.
We have a cancer registry program with a certified registrar who tracks our cancer statistics and follows our cancer patients. Monthly tumor boards are held where all disciplines can participate in discussion and treatment planning for cancer patients.
OSCAR (Oncology Symptom Control and Research) Program
Bedford Regional Medical Center is privileged to offer our cancer patients the OSCAR program. This stands for oncology symptom control and research. Patients with pain, fatigue and depression participate in clinical trials related to quality of life issues.
